The
purpose of WINE is to provide a common platform for European
women's libraries to participate in joint European projects
in the field of education and research in gender, women's and
feminist studies. In this direction, WINE already co-operates
with ATHENA to strengthen the link between academic research
and information/documentation.
It
aims at:
- co-ordinating the development of the partners' facilities
in the direction of training and research;
- creating positive synergies with university programmes
in Women's Studies;
- fulfilling a representative function for its partners
within different programmes of the European Commission in
the field of information and documentation services on women
and gender.
- setting up specific regional meetings for professionals
in the field, which will take place in the time-slots in-between
the larger international 'Know How' conferences.
- broadening the number of partner institutions from all
the European countries. Therefore special attention is given
in both WINE and ATHENA to the development of co-operative
ties with Eastern and Southern European partners.
